Examples of Teaching/Learning Assignments, Projects, Methods

  • Most courses require a comprehensive portfolio which documents learning in that particular course
  • Frequent use of real-life situations are included in courses. Students interact with children, parents and community members both in and outside the classroom and gain immediate feedback.
  • In the capstone course students are required to compile and present a comprehensive portfolio of all learning that has occurred in each program outcome. This portfolio is presented and defended prior to completion of the program.

Evidence of Learning Outcome Achievement

  • Employers report a high level of satisfaction with graduates of the program
  • Program just achieved state-wide accreditation (only the 7th program in the state to achieve this). Graduates are eligible for pre Kindergarten licensure.
  • Students enrolled in the program consistently rate the value of the program high in supporting their career goals and learning objectives.
  • The students’ oral communication, written communication and critical thinking skills consistently improve as they progress through the program as measured by faculty developed rubrics.
